How far do you run in cross country?
Cross-country is a team running sport that takes place in the fall on a measured 5000 meter (3.1 miles) High School course or 2 mile course for the Jr. High over varied surfaces and terrain.

How does cross country work?
Cross Country is similar to golf in that the lowest score wins. A perfect score is 15 points, with the top five runners occupying the first five finishing positions. Runners who do not have a full team are removed from the results for team scoring. This happens quite often at larger races.
Is cross country only long distance?
cross-country, also called cross-country running, long-distance running over open country; unlike the longer marathon race, cross-country races usually are not run along roads or paths.

How do I train for cross country?
For your recovery intervals, go at an easy pace, which means a slow jog or walking:
- Warm up: 5-minute easy jog including 1–3 30-second accelerations (strides)
- Run: 30-second sprint at 5K pace.
- Recover: 1 minute at an easy pace.
- Repeat: Do the run/recover cycle for a total of 20 minutes.
- Cooldown: 5-minute easy jog.

How long is an Olympic cross country race?
Distances. Courses for international competitions consist of a loop between 1750 and 2000 meters. Athletes complete three to six loops, depending on the race. Senior men and women compete on a 10 kilometre course.
